Foundational Elements: The Quintessential Components
At its core, a Vatican City visa invitation letter should contain several indispensable elements. Firstly, it must explicitly state the inviter’s full name, address, and contact information.
This is crucial for verification purposes. Secondly, the letter needs to meticulously detail the invitee’s full name, date of birth, nationality, and passport number. Inaccurate details can engender significant delays or, worse, outright rejection. Don’t forget this vital information.
Purpose and Duration: Defining the Intention
Specificity reigns supreme! Clearly articulate the purpose of the invitee’s visit. Is it for pilgrimage? A conference? A private visit? Be unambiguous. The duration of the intended stay must also be explicitly stated, including the exact entry and exit dates. Vagueness here is anathema to a successful application. So, be precise.
Financial Solvency: Addressing the Monetary Question
A crucial aspect often overlooked is the demonstration of financial responsibility. The letter should address who will bear the financial burden of the invitee’s stay. Will the inviter be responsible for accommodation, meals, and other expenses?
Or will the invitee be self-sufficient? Clarity on this matter can preempt potential concerns regarding the applicant’s ability to subsist during their sojourn. It’s important to remember this.
Authentication and Legibility: Ensuring Veracity
The letter must be impeccably typed and printed on official letterhead (if applicable). Handwritten letters, while occasionally acceptable, are generally less persuasive.
Most importantly, the letter must be signed and dated by the inviter. Illegible signatures can raise suspicion, so ensure clarity. A clear, well-presented document speaks volumes about the seriousness of the invitation.
Supporting Documentation: Bolstering the Credibility
While the invitation letter is paramount, it is often prudent to supplement it with pertinent supporting documentation. This might include copies of the inviter’s passport or identification card, proof of residence in Vatican City (if applicable), and any other documents that corroborate the legitimacy of the invitation.
A Proviso of Caution: Avoiding Pitfalls
It is imperative to remember that an invitation letter does not guarantee visa issuance. The ultimate decision rests with the visa authorities. Moreover, avoid making any false or misleading statements in the letter.
Honesty and transparency are non-negotiable. Providing inaccurate information can have severe repercussions, potentially jeopardizing future visa applications. So, be ethical in your approach.
FAQs about Vatican City Visa Invitation Letter
Who needs a Vatican City Visa Invitation Letter?
A Vatican City Visa Invitation Letter is generally not required for short visits. Since Vatican City does not issue its own visas and is part of the Schengen Area, entry is governed by Italian/Schengen visa regulations.
However, if you are invited for a specific event or purpose by a Vatican institution, having an invitation letter from that institution might be helpful as supporting documentation for your Italian/Schengen visa application.
What information should be included in a Vatican City Visa Invitation Letter?
Typically, an invitation letter should include the full name, date of birth, and passport details of the invitee (the person needing the visa). It should also specify the purpose of the visit, the dates of the intended stay, and the name and contact information of the inviting organization or individual within Vatican City.
How do I obtain a Vatican City Visa Invitation Letter?
An invitation letter can only be obtained from an organization or individual within Vatican City who is inviting you for a specific purpose. You cannot request it from the Vatican City government directly unless you have a pre-existing relationship or arrangement with a Vatican-based entity.
Is a Vatican City Visa Invitation Letter a guarantee of visa approval?
No, an invitation letter is not a guarantee of visa approval. It serves as supplementary documentation to support your visa application by providing evidence of the purpose of your visit and the arrangements made.
The final decision on visa issuance rests with the Italian consulate or embassy processing your application, based on their assessment of your overall eligibility and adherence to visa requirements.
Where should I submit the Vatican City Visa Invitation Letter?
The invitation letter should be submitted along with your visa application to the Italian consulate or embassy responsible for processing visa applications in your country of residence.
Since Vatican City does not issue visas, you must apply for an Italian/Schengen visa. The invitation letter should be included as part of your supporting documents.
